#818924 Color
#818924 is rgb(129, 137, 36) in RGB, hsl(65, 58%, 34%) in HSL, and about cmyk(6%, 0%, 74%, 46%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Olive (#808000),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.83.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#818924 Channel Values
How #818924 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 129 · G 137 · B 36 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 65° · S 58% · L 34%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 65° · S 74% · V 54%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 6% · M 0% · Y 74% · K 46%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.79:1 vs white · 5.54: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#818924 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#818924 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#818924?
#818924 is a dark green — rgb(129, 137, 36) in RGB and hsl(65, 58%, 34%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Olive (#808000),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.83.
What is the RGB value of #818924?
#818924 is rgb(129, 137, 36) — red 129, green 137, and blue 36 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#818924?
#818924 converts to approximately cmyk(6%, 0%, 74%, 46%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#818924 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#818924 scores 3.79:1 against white and 5.54: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#818924 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#818924 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is olive (#808000) at a CIE76 distance of 7.83,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
